Hang‐Bae Jun is a scholar working on Environmental Engineering, Building and Construction and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Hang‐Bae Jun has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Environmental Engineering, 24 papers in Building and Construction and 21 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Hang‐Bae Jun's work include Anaerobic Digestion and Biogas Production (24 papers),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(21 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(21 papers). Hang‐Bae Jun is often cited by papers focused on Anaerobic Digestion and Biogas Production (24 papers),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(21 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(21 papers). Hang‐Bae Jun coll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and India. Hang‐Bae Jun's co-authors include Jungyu Park, Beom Lee, Beom Soo Kim, Sang Mun Jeong, Dongjie Tian, En Mei Jin, Prasun Kumar, Tae‐Young Heo, Daqian Jiang and Hyeon Jeong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Water Research and Bioresource Technology.
